2M of 100 ml Na2SO4 is mixed with 3M of 100 ml NaCl solution and 1M of 200 ml CaCl2 solution. Then the ratio of the concentration of cation and anion is ___?

Solution: Number of moles = Molarity × volume of solution in litre Number of moles of Na2SO4=2×0.1=0.2 Number of moles of NaCl=3×0.1=0.3 Number of moles of CaCl2=1×0.2=0.2 Number of moles of cation (0.2×2)+0.3+0.2=0.9 Number of moles of anion 0.2+0.3+(0.2×2)=0.9 Ratio of number of moles of cation to anion is=0.9 / 0.9=1
